Output 1d3fa9bff3cd7626f0c50e7ac1a16af07231819f0eede595370b50e079a9feee:32

value
531442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c6c1034affdceeec4aa2e732c66f7cae982f27c OP_EQUAL
address
32phVDTtooysQfoEowADEp4VA5LHcKUU25
transaction
1d3fa9bff3cd7626f0c50e7ac1a16af07231819f0eede595370b50e079a9feee
confirmations
218671
spent
true